Categorías destacadas
programacion php    
Lista de foros

Problema parseo XML


Marcos del Amo
23 de Noviembre del 2010

Buenas a todos!

Tengo un problemilla de cara a parsear un fichero XML.

La estructura del fichero es la siguiente:





32
23
13
23
40
21
18
15
21
34
56
49

....
....

33
56
59
46
54
43
12
16
26
48
53
63




El fichero viene reflejando las ventas en cada mes de distintos emplea
dos de la empresa. El problema que me surge es que no se como "partir" la linea de ya que volumen simboliza el nuevo empleado y luego cod simoliza cual es el código del mismo.

public void startElement(String namespace, String sName, String qName, Attributes atrs) throws SAXException {
...
else if (qName.equals("volumen")) {
if (qName.equals("cod")) {

....

}

Pero esta opcion d anidar el if no funciona, lo comprobe tras depurar por lo que el problema viene ahí y claro...luego ya se parsea mal y salta una excepción. Pero el problema viene de ahí seguro. ¿Se podria solucionar quizas utilizando alguno de los parametros que se llegan por cabecera a este método?¿Alguien me podría ayudar?

Muchas gracias de antemano.Un saludo a tod@s


Marcos del Amo
23 de Noviembre del 2010

Disculpar pero se copiaron mal los datos del XML. Los pongo de nuevo.





32
23
13
23
40
21
18
15
21
34
56
49

....
....

33
56
59
46
54
43
12
16
26
48
53
63


 
BBDD
Entornos de desarrollo
Entretenimiento
Herramientas
Internet
Lenguajes de script
Lenguajes imperativos
Lenguajes orientados a objeto
Otros lenguajes
Plataformas
Teoría
Varios
Copyright © 1998-2011 Programación en Castellano. Todos los derechos reservados
Datos legales | Politica de privacidad | Contacte con nosotros | Publicidad

Diseño web y desarrollo web. Un proyecto de los hermanos Carrero.

Red internet:
Juegos gratis | Servidores dedicados
Más internet: Password | Directorio de weblogs | Favicon